Использование какао для создания веб-сервера HTTP - PullRequest
0 голосов
/ 07 февраля 2012

Я нахожусь в процессе создания пакета приложений, который требует, чтобы веб-сервер работал на OS X для получения HTTP-запросов от устройства iOS (или любого другого веб-устройства на самом деле). Как только запрос получен, серверное приложение затем запросит базу данных MySQL, отформатирует результат в XML и вернет результат в приложение iOS. Создание приложения iOS и приложения OS X для запроса MySQL не является проблемой, но я понятия не имею, как создать часть веб-сервера (т. Е. Иметь приложение Cocoa, прослушивающее входящие запросы и т. Д.). Это хорошая идея, чтобы как-то использовать Apache в качестве веб-сервера? Если да, то как мне это сделать (т.е. модули Apache, мосты PERL и Какао)? Если нет, каковы альтернативы? Это приложение (в случае успеха) потенциально может иметь много пользователей, поэтому веб-сервер должен быть защищен (отсюда и причина изучения Apache).

Ответы [ 2 ]

0 голосов
/ 17 сентября 2012

Старый поток, но, тем не менее, возможный ответ для других: WebAppKit обеспечивает чрезвычайно простой для понимания подход для обработки HTTP-запросов и ответов. Идеальное решение для того, что вы описываете (насколько я могу судить из вашего описания).

0 голосов
/ 07 февраля 2012

Некоторое простое поиск в Google доставило учебник и реализацию с открытым исходным кодом веб-сервера. Может быть, хорошей идеей было бы начать с этих ресурсов?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...